NextGen Climate will live stream two Puppies at the Polls events in battleground states to get out the vote. On college campuses in New Hampshire and Pennsylvania, NextGen Climate will live stream the puppies on Facebook allowing everyone to join in on the fun through social media. Each puppy live stream will last for 2 hours. The first get out the vote event will be in New Hampshire at the University of New Hampshire in Durham, and the second will be in Pennsylvania at Bryn Mawr College.
“We want to make sure every young voter makes it to the polls today, so we’ve enlisted our most loyal companions to help during this historic Election Day,” said NextGen Climate National Puppy Coordinator Nick Ellis. “We are confident that our canine counterparts will help us to turn out young voters for climate champions like Hillary Clinton, Maggie Hassan and Katie McGinty.”
Puppies at the Polls has been a successful way to make sure young people get to the polls in battleground states in the last few days. In some states, NextGen Climate has expanded its animal team to include sloths, kangaroos, and penguins. NextGen Climate is running the largest campus outreach program in the country, engaging millennials on 300 campuses in 13 battleground states.
